Contracts Administrator

NorthStar Energy Services is seeking a detail-oriented Contracts Administrator to support the administration, coordination, and maintenance of contracts supporting engineering, procurement, and construction activities. This position works closely with project management, procurement, operations, accounting, and other internal stakeholders to help ensure contractual documentation is complete, accurate, properly executed, and maintained throughout the project lifecycle.

NorthStar Energy Services, a Quanta Services company, provides engineering, design, procurement, construction, and support services to the chemical, petrochemical, pipeline, oil & gas, bulk storage, and terminal industries and delivers both individual project services and turnkey EPC project implementation.

Responsibilities

  • Administer and maintain customer, subcontractor, vendor, and supplier contracts, purchase agreements, amendments, change orders, and other contractual documentation.
  • Coordinate contract documentation from initiation through execution, ensuring required approvals, signatures, insurance documentation, and supporting records are obtained and properly maintained.
  • Review contracts and related documents for completeness, established commercial requirements, deliverables, dates, and administrative compliance; escalate exceptions or contractual concerns to appropriate management.
  • Maintain accurate contract files, logs, tracking systems, and databases, including key dates, notices, renewals, change orders, deliverables, and closeout documentation.
  • Partner with Project Management, Procurement, Accounting, and Operations to support contract compliance, invoicing requirements, subcontract administration, and resolution of documentation discrepancies.
  • Assist with preparation and processing of contract modifications, change documentation, correspondence, notices, and other project-related commercial records.
  • Support audits, project closeouts, reporting, and continuous improvement of contract administration processes while maintaining confidentiality of company and customer information.

Qualifications

  • High school diploma or equivalent required; associate or b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Supply Chain, Construction Management, Finance, or a related field preferred.
  • 3-8 years of contract administration, procurement, project administration, or related experience; experience within engineering, construction, EPC, oil & gas, petrochemical, or industrial services is preferred.
  • Working knowledge of contracts, purchase orders, subcontracts, change orders, and general commercial documentation.
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ail with the ability to manage multiple contracts, priorities, deadlines, and stakeholders simultaneously.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ills with the ability to work effectively across project, operational, financial, and supply chain teams.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office applications; experience with ERP, procurement, contract-management, or document-control systems is preferred.
  • Ability to exercise sound judgment when identifying documentation issues and escalating contractual or commercial matters to the appropriate authority.
  • Ability to travel occasionally based on project or business needs.
